Maya skateboard rig questions

sup folks. I'm working on a freelance project that involves lots of animation, and I'm making a mini skateboard rig for the character. This is my first time rigging anything in Maya and I keep stumbling on lots of things.

The skateboard is basically simple geometry with the rotation of the wheels driven by an expression. when you move the skateboard geo, the wheels rotate. I am having trouble making the rig a bit more sophisticated, however.

When I make a control curve for the whole skateboard, the skateboard geo reappears in another location after I parent the geo to the curve and when I move the curve. Freezing transforms only gives me a message saying the skateboard object is a child of the world. What should I be doing to ensure once I make the control curve, the geo stays put?

Also, when I place the character on the skateboard, should I parent the global character rig control to the skateboard rig control or is there a better way?


I want to separate the trucks of the skateboard and make it so they squash and stretch as the skateboard deck banks on the x axis. I can separate the trucks with a script but am not sure how to go about rigging a bank for the board. This isn't as important as my first question, though, and I'm sure I'll figure it out.
